Output e07a1e995861af72d69560e523288b64498401fecdfd73256d40f4f32a0c6daa:0

value
26648580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595506d83e942d768bac1e43f3e3877fa485d98b OP_EQUAL
address
39qMvNsbiode2DuRuGWUtwihUkHNLhzYLs
transaction
e07a1e995861af72d69560e523288b64498401fecdfd73256d40f4f32a0c6daa
spent
true